Rare FetaCheese Posted September 27, 2022 #6 Share Posted September 27, 2022 V plan rates are the same for all ages. Other companies underwrite by age tiers.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Rare CCWineLover Posted September 27, 2022 #7 Share Posted September 27, 2022 1 hour ago, FetaCheese said: V plan rates are the same for all ages. Other companies underwrite by age tiers. What is V Plan? Haven't heard of them. It is true the most companies DO go by age tiers, so it will cost you more the older you get (sadly!). Getting that first payment down before a birthday is paramount and can save a lot. I learned this from Steve at The Insurance Store.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

The Other Tom Posted September 27, 2022 #9 Share Posted September 27, 2022 3 hours ago, WNcruiser said: Every plan Steve offers covers Covid. I, too, purchased the IMG plan. Note that you have to be diagnosed by a doctor for the covid portion of the insurance to pay. Steve explains all this on his website but sometimes people may skip over the details.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
